Victim says Fairborn rape suspect nearly killed her

A Fairborn woman said a man sexually assaulted her and held her against her will and now the man is facing serious charges.

Michael Harris, 31, is charged with kidnapping, rape and other felony charges and remains in the Greene County Jail. He was arrested earlier this month.

“I can’t sleep at night.  My mind just races and I don’t feel safe,” the victim said. “I just hope justice is served...he doesn’t need to be out here.”

The victim said Harris came to her house and they left in Harris’ truck.

The victim said the alleged sexual assault may have happened in the truck.  The victim was able to escape out of the vehicle on Ohio Street, because Harris was said to have left the doors of the truck unlocked, a police report said.

The woman called her roommate, who then called 911.

Police were able to arrest Harris shortly after he ditched his vehicle and ran.

The victim told News Center 7’s Gabrielle Enright that Harris nearly killed her.

Harris remains in jail on a $100,000 bond.
